Biography: The Early Years and Beyond

Lisa Valerie Kudrow was born in Encino, California, on July 30, 1963. Her family background, you know, is quite interesting, with her ancestors hailing from Belarus. Her father, Lee Kudrow, was a physician specializing in headache and migraine, and her mother, Nedra, was a travel agent. Growing up in a professional household, she apparently had a very academic inclination from an early age, which might be a bit surprising for someone who became known for her comedic timing.

Before she ever stepped onto a major set, Lisa Kudrow actually pursued a path that was quite different from acting. She graduated from Vassar College with a Bachelor of Arts degree in Biology. This academic background is a really unique part of her story, and it shows a different side to her capabilities, doesn't it? For a time, she even worked with her father on research, studying cluster headaches. This scientific rigor, in a way, could be seen as a foundation for her later meticulous approach to character development, or so it seems.

Her pivot from science to comedy wasn't an overnight thing, by any means. It was a gradual shift, sparked by a friend's encouragement. She started getting involved in improv comedy, which is really where her natural comedic talents began to shine. Comedy and Improv: Honing Her Craft

The true crucible for Lisa Kudrow's performance skills was undoubtedly the world of improv comedy. She became a member of The Groundlings, a renowned improvisational and sketch comedy troupe in Los Angeles. This experience is really where she sharpened her comedic timing, developed characters on the fly, and learned to collaborate seamlessly with other performers. Improv, you know, demands quick thinking and an ability to react authentically in the moment, which are vital skills for any actor, especially in comedy.

Working with The Groundlings meant she was constantly creating and performing, often without a script. Iconic Roles and Versatility

While many know her best as Phoebe Buffay from "Friends," Lisa Kudrow's qualifications extend far beyond that single, iconic role. Her portrayal of Phoebe showcased her extraordinary ability to blend whimsy, sincerity, and a touch of eccentricity, creating a character that resonated with millions. This role required not just comedic timing but also a surprising depth of emotion, especially in moments where Phoebe's troubled past would surface. It was, you know, a very complex character to play.

Before "Friends," she had already made a mark as Ursula Buffay, Phoebe's twin sister, on "Mad About You." Playing two distinct characters, even if related, on two different popular shows at the same time, showed her range and ability to differentiate performances. This kind of dual role is, in some respects, a demonstration of significant acting prowess, isn't it? It proved she could handle diverse comedic styles and character nuances.

Beyond comedy, Lisa Kudrow has also taken on more dramatic roles, showcasing her versatility. Films like "The Opposite of Sex" and "Wonderland" allowed her to explore different facets of her acting talent. Her performance in "The Comeback," where she played Valerie Cherish, an aging sitcom star trying to revive her career, earned her critical acclaim and an Emmy nomination. Beyond Acting: Producing and Creating

Lisa Kudrow's qualifications aren't limited to just performing in front of the camera. She has also made significant contributions behind the scenes as a producer and creator. This shows a deeper understanding of the entertainment business and a desire to shape projects from their inception. Her involvement in shows like "The Comeback," which she co-created and executive produced, demonstrates her vision and leadership skills. It's not just about acting; it's about building a story from the ground up, you know.

She also produced and starred in the genealogy reality series "Who Do You Think You Are?" This project, which explores celebrities' family histories, highlights her interest in storytelling and non-fiction content. It requires a different set of skills than acting, including research, interviewing, and narrative structuring.
